Keyclick
With keyclick enabled, a "click" sound will be issued when a front panel key is
pressed. For the Model 6221, a "click" will also be issued when the rotary knob is
turned or pressed. Keyclick can only be controlled using remote operation:
SYSTem:KCLick <b>

Source preset

The PRES key can be used to set the source to a preset value. When the PRES
key is pressed, the source will set to the preset value ("PRES" message dis-
played). When the PRES key is pressed again, the unit will return to the original
source value. See

Disabling the front panel

The front panel can be disabled. While disabled, display characters and annuncia-
tors are turned off. Also, all front panel controls (except LOCAL and DISP) are
locked out.
